ORDINANCE 2���0'� � - COUNCIL FILE NO f� G PRESENTED BY f ORDINANCE NO �d' nce ame ding Ordinance No. 6446, entitled: "An administrative ordinance fixi.ng the com- pensation rates of certa.in city positions and employments, " . approved January 23, 1925, as amended. THE COUNCIL OF THE CITY OF SAIlVT PAUL DOES ORDAIN: � Section 1. That Ordinance No. 6446, approved January 23, 1925, � as amended, be and the same is hereby further amended by striking out of Section ZI, in the last paragraph in each of Groups A, B, and G, the word "gross"; and by substituti.ng in lieu thereof the words "total hourly wa.ge". Section 2. That said ordinance, as amended, be and the same is , hereby further amended by striking out the section ntunber and caption readi.ng as follows: • , "VI SALA.RY FORMULA-- ", and by substituti.ng in lieu thereof the following: � � "VI SALARY FORMULA - GRADED DIV.ISION--". • Section 3. That sa�id ordinance, as amended, be and the same is ' hereby further amended by adding, �after the material i.n Section VI, the , ` following: _ "5ection VII SALARY FORMULA. - UNGRADED DIVISION-- A The following words or phrases shall, for the purpose of this , section, have the meanangs respectively ascribed to them herei.n: 1 Basic hourly wage rate-- The basic hourly wage rate is the total cents per hour paid directly to the employee including State and Federal ta.xes and employee Social Security payments, excludi_n.g any other benefits. 2 Total hourly wage rate-- The total hourly wage rate is the basic hourly wage rate as defined above, and in addition thereto, all cents-per-.hour payments provided for in applicable contracts i.n industry for . � . i _1_ . B At least once each year and more frequently if so directed by �� resolution of the City Council, the Civil Service Commissioner shall cause to be reviewed or surveyed contracts in industry ° pertaining to the same or similar types or classes of employment as those defined under the Ungraded Division in Section 3A of ' Ordinance No. �3250 and ascertain the salary rate effective or to be effective in industry for the ensuing annua.l contract year or shorter contractual wage period, if such be recognized in industry . � under existent contracts, next following the date of such survey � and report thereon to the City Counci.l. Such surveys shall be conducted by the Civi.l Service Bureau within the two-month period prior to the recognized annual anniversary date of such contracts in industry; or if the established wage period in industry is for a shorter term, the Civil Service Bureau shall initiate such surveys during the two-month period prior to the expiration of such recog- nized wage period under existent contracts in industry. Such surveys • • and reports shall include the following information: 1 For those classes of positions listed in Groups A, B, and G of Section II of this Ordinance, 86. 5°jo of the total hourly wage rate as found in each contract submitted to the Civil Servlce Bureau by a representative of a union which negotiated such contract in private industry which pertain to the same^or similar type of work. . -- . ._ ..rx., ..` - - 2 For those classes of positions listed in Group C of Section II of this Ordinance, 86. 5% of the average of the total hourly wage rate � of Carpenter Foreman,. Electrician Foreman, Plasterer Foreman, Plumber Foreman, and Sheet Metal Worker Foreman as shown i.n � contracts submitted as in No. 1 above. The Civil Service Bureau shall submit a report of its findings to the Council and shall also file for public record a copy with the City Clerk. Thereafter,, the Council shall set a public hearing for the purpose of � • reviewing existent wa.ge rates, which hearing shall be not less than ten ` days nor more than twenty days after such public notice as the Council . i may deem necessary. After such hearing the Council shall, by resolution, determine appropriate hourly rates for �ra.rious groups �considering, among other things, in arriving at such determinations � the�following factors: � ' f (a� In Groups A, B, and G of Section ZI of this Ordinance, the rates reported in No. 1 above for each individual class. , � (b} In Group C of Section II of this Ordinance, the rate reported . % , in No. 2 above for the class Building Inspector and the same cents-per�hour change for all other classes in this group. (c� In Group D of Section II of this Ordinance, the rate indicated � in No. 3 above b� applyi.ng said average rate to the class • Custodian-Engineer I and the same centsper-hour change , for all other classes in this group. ' `(d) �In Group E of Section II of this Ordinance, the rate indicated � ' in 1Vo.� 4 alsove�-b� applyang said average rate to the class Pumping Engineer I and the same cents-per-hour change for all other classes an this group. , � . (e) In Group F of Section JI of this Ordi.nance, the rates indicated in No. 5 above for auto mechanic by applying said total rate to the class Auto Mechanic and the same cents�er-hour change . for all classes in this group except Tire Repairman; to arrive at the rate indicated in No. 5 above for tire repairman by applying said total rate to t�ie class Tire Repairman. A11 wage rate changes shall become effective on the first day' of the first payroll period first following the date seven calendar days before the effective industry contract date of such increases, and ne� following . completion of :such survey and passage of such aforesaid resolution by the Council; or if such survey and resolution follows such contract dated then the rate changes shall become effective the first day of the first payroll period next follovcwing completion of such survey and passage of _� , such aforesaid resolution�iy the Counci.l. � '. _3..
